Rutgers survives in Big Ten women's tournament, tops Purdue behind Tyler Scaife

Related Topics: Big Ten Conference

Heading into the Big Ten Tournament, the Rutgers women's basketball team figured to need at least one win to have any hopes for an NCAA Tournament berth.

The Scarlet Knights accomplished that Thursday afternoon, surviving a second-round thriller thanks to Tyler Scaife, whose jumper with four seconds to play snapped a deadlock and resulted in a 62-60 triumph in the 8-9 game at Bankers Life Fieldhouse in Indianapolis.

"I wanted the ball in my hands, so I went and got it,'' Scaife said. "I'm not afraid of the moment. My teammates believe in me, and so does the coaching staff.
